/*
 * On some platforms accept() calls from different processes
 * on the same listen socket must be serialized.
 * The following code serializes accept()'s without process blocking.
 * A pipe is used as an inter-process semaphore.
 */
int st_netfd_serialize_accept(_st_netfd_t *fd)
{
    _st_netfd_t **p;
    int osfd[2], err;
    
    if (fd->aux_data) {
        errno = EINVAL;
        return -1;
    }
    if ((p = (_st_netfd_t **)calloc(2, sizeof(_st_netfd_t *))) == NULL) {
        return -1;
    }
    if (pipe(osfd) < 0) {
        free(p);
        return -1;
    }
    if ((p[0] = st_netfd_open(osfd[0])) != NULL && (p[1] = st_netfd_open(osfd[1])) != NULL && write(osfd[1], " ", 1) == 1) {
        fd->aux_data = p;
        return 0;
    }
    /* Error */
    err = errno;
    if (p[0]) {
        st_netfd_free(p[0]);
    }
    if (p[1]) {
        st_netfd_free(p[1]);
    }
    close(osfd[0]);
    close(osfd[1]);
    free(p);
    errno = err;
    
    return -1;
}

static void _st_netfd_free_aux_data(_st_netfd_t *fd)
{
    _st_netfd_t **p = (_st_netfd_t **) fd->aux_data;
    
    st_netfd_close(p[0]);
    st_netfd_close(p[1]);
    free(p);
    fd->aux_data = NULL;
}

int st_connect(_st_netfd_t *fd, const struct sockaddr *addr, int addrlen, st_utime_t timeout)
{
    int n, err = 0;
    
    while (connect(fd->osfd, addr, addrlen) < 0) {
        if (errno != EINTR) {
            /*
            * On some platforms, if connect() is interrupted (errno == EINTR)
            * after the kernel binds the socket, a subsequent connect()
            * attempt will fail with errno == EADDRINUSE.  Ignore EADDRINUSE
            * iff connect() was previously interrupted.  See Rich Stevens'
            * "UNIX Network Programming," Vol. 1, 2nd edition, p. 413
            * ("Interrupted connect").
            */
            if (errno != EINPROGRESS && (errno != EADDRINUSE || err == 0)) {
                return -1;
            }
            /* Wait until the socket becomes writable */
            if (st_netfd_poll(fd, POLLOUT, timeout) < 0) {
                return -1;
            }
            /* Try to find out whether the connection setup succeeded or failed */
            n = sizeof(int);
            if (getsockopt(fd->osfd, SOL_SOCKET, SO_ERROR, (char *)&err, (socklen_t *)&n) < 0) {
                return -1;
            }
            if (err) {
                errno = err;
                return -1;
            }
            break;
        }
        err = 1;
    }
    
    return 0;
}

ssize_t st_writev(_st_netfd_t *fd, const struct iovec *iov, int iov_size, st_utime_t timeout)
{
    ssize_t n, rv;
    size_t nleft, nbyte;
    int index, iov_cnt;
    struct iovec *tmp_iov;
    struct iovec local_iov[_LOCAL_MAXIOV];
    
    /* Calculate the total number of bytes to be sent */
    nbyte = 0;
    for (index = 0; index < iov_size; index++) {
        nbyte += iov[index].iov_len;
    }
    
    rv = (ssize_t)nbyte;
    nleft = nbyte;
    tmp_iov = (struct iovec *) iov;    /* we promise not to modify iov */
    iov_cnt = iov_size;
    
    while (nleft > 0) {
        if (iov_cnt == 1) {
            if (st_write(fd, tmp_iov[0].iov_base, nleft, timeout) != (ssize_t) nleft) {
                rv = -1;
            }
            break;
        }
        if ((n = writev(fd->osfd, tmp_iov, iov_cnt)) < 0) {
            if (errno == EINTR) {
                continue;
            }
            if (!_IO_NOT_READY_ERROR) {
                rv = -1;
                break;
            }
        } else {
            if ((size_t) n == nleft) {
                break;
            }
            nleft -= n;
            /* Find the next unwritten vector */
            n = (ssize_t)(nbyte - nleft);
            for (index = 0; (size_t) n >= iov[index].iov_len; index++) {
                n -= iov[index].iov_len;
            }
            
            if (tmp_iov == iov) {
                /* Must copy iov's around */
                if (iov_size - index <= _LOCAL_MAXIOV) {
                    tmp_iov = local_iov;
                } else {
                    tmp_iov = calloc(1, (iov_size - index) * sizeof(struct iovec));
                    if (tmp_iov == NULL) {
                        return -1;
                    }
                }
            }
            
            /* Fill in the first partial read */
            tmp_iov[0].iov_base = &(((char *)iov[index].iov_base)[n]);
            tmp_iov[0].iov_len = iov[index].iov_len - n;
            index++;
            /* Copy the remaining vectors */
            for (iov_cnt = 1; index < iov_size; iov_cnt++, index++) {
                tmp_iov[iov_cnt].iov_base = iov[index].iov_base;
                tmp_iov[iov_cnt].iov_len = iov[index].iov_len;
            }
        }
        /* Wait until the socket becomes writable */
        if (st_netfd_poll(fd, POLLOUT, timeout) < 0) {
            rv = -1;
            break;
        }
    }
    
    if (tmp_iov != iov && tmp_iov != local_iov) {
        free(tmp_iov);
    }
    
    return rv;
}
